Reported risk: This recall involves Panasonic lithium-ion battery packs for these Fujitsu notebook computers and workstations: CELSIUS H720, LIFEBOOK E752, E733, E743, E753, P702, P772, S710, S752, S762, T732, T734, and T902. Recalled battery pack product numbers are CP556150-03, CP579060-01 and CP629458-03. The product and serial numbers are printed on a white sticker on the battery. Serial numbers included in the recall are: Recalled Battery Pack Part and Serial Numbers Product Number (P/N) Serial Numbers The first 7 characters The last 7 characters CP556150-03 Z130119 All Z130120 000038Z - 004207Z Z130131 - Z130205 All CP579060-01 Z130129 All Z130130 All Z130131 000089Z - 000662Z Z130221 All Z130304 000045Z - 000563Z 001210Z - 001963Z 002302Z - 002847Z Z130306 000017Z - 000524Z CP629458-03 Z130301 - Z130407 All Hazards: The lithium-ion battery packs can overheat, posing burn and fire hazards to consumers.
